Assigning Thanks to Reporters

Acknowledge Efforts & Valuable Contributions of Bug Reporters by sending them a Thanks Message

This feature allows program owners to express their gratitude and appreciation to the reporters who have contributed to improving the security of their applications. In addition to assigning monetary rewards for valid bug reports, program owners now have the option to assign thanks to reporters as a way of acknowledging their efforts and valuable contributions.

Thanks can only be assigned when marking the Report as Resolved or Informational

Conveying Thanks to a Reporter in a Particular Report

  1. Navigate to a Report

  2. Go to the Top Action Bar of the Report and click on the "Change Report Status" button.

  3. When Marking a Report as Resolved or Informational, a Text Box will appear where you can add a Thanks Message to the Reporter acknowledging their efforts and valuable contributions in reporting the bug.

  4. Enter the Thanks Message & Mark the Report as Resolved or Informational

Once the Thanks has been Assigned, it will show up in the Report Thread

Assigning Thanks is mandatory when No Reward (Bounty/Swag) is assigned while marking a Bug Report as Resolved. In any other flow of changing report status it is an optional field (Incase of marking a report Informational)
